Measure and Cut: Trim drain to fit shower space using a hacksaw or tile cutter

Before you begin trimming your shower trench drain, ensure you have the necessary tools: a measuring tape, a marker, a hacksaw or tile cutter, safety gloves, and safety goggles. Start by measuring the length of the space where the trench drain will be installed. Place the drain in the designated area and mark the excess length that needs to be removed. Double-check your measurements to ensure accuracy, as cutting too much will render the drain unusable. If your trench drain has pre-marked cutting lines, align these with your measurements for precision.

Once you’ve marked the cutting point, secure the trench drain firmly in place to prevent it from moving during the cutting process. If using a hacksaw, position the blade at the marked line and begin cutting steadily, applying even pressure. For metal drains, use a fine-toothed blade to ensure a clean cut. If using a tile cutter, align the drain with the cutter’s guide and apply firm, consistent pressure to score and snap the drain at the marked point. Always wear safety goggles to protect your eyes from debris.

After cutting, inspect the trimmed edge for any rough spots or burrs. Use a metal file or sandpaper to smooth the edges, ensuring they are safe and fit properly into the shower space. Test the drain by placing it back into the designated area to confirm it fits snugly and aligns with the slope of the shower floor. If adjustments are needed, remeasure and make minor cuts as necessary.

When trimming a trench drain with a grate, ensure the cut does not interfere with the grate’s alignment or functionality. Measure and mark the drain body only, avoiding any areas where the grate attaches. After cutting, reattach the grate and verify that it sits evenly and securely. If the grate no longer fits properly, you may need to trim it separately using a similar method.

Finally, clean the trimmed drain thoroughly to remove any metal shavings or debris before installation. This step is crucial to prevent clogs or damage to the waterproofing membrane. Once cleaned, proceed with installing the drain according to the manufacturer’s instructions, ensuring proper sealing and alignment for optimal drainage. Proper measurement and cutting are key to a successful trench drain installation.

Install New Drain: Secure drain in place, ensuring proper slope for water flow

When installing a new shower trench drain, securing it in place while ensuring the proper slope for water flow is crucial for effective drainage and preventing water pooling. Begin by preparing the trench area, ensuring it is clean and free of debris. Place the new drain assembly into the trench, aligning it with the shower’s layout. Most trench drains come with adjustable legs or supports that allow you to set the correct slope. The slope should typically be 1/4 inch per foot toward the outlet to facilitate proper water flow. Use a level to verify the slope, making adjustments as needed by turning the legs or adding shims beneath the drain.

Once the slope is confirmed, secure the drain in place according to the manufacturer’s instructions. This often involves fastening the drain to the subfloor using screws or brackets provided with the drain kit. Ensure the connections are tight and stable to prevent movement during use. If the drain includes a grate or cover, attach it securely but ensure it can be removed for cleaning and maintenance. Double-check the slope again after securing the drain to ensure it hasn’t shifted during installation.

Next, integrate the drain with the shower’s waterproofing system. Apply a waterproof membrane or sealant around the edges of the drain to prevent water from seeping beneath it. This step is essential to protect the subfloor and surrounding structure from water damage. Follow the waterproofing product’s instructions for proper application and drying times. Once the waterproofing is complete, test the drain by pouring water into the trench to ensure it flows smoothly toward the outlet without obstruction.

Finally, complete the installation by tiling or finishing the shower floor around the drain. Ensure the tiles slope slightly toward the trench drain to guide water into it. Use a tile adhesive and grout that are suitable for wet areas, and allow sufficient time for them to cure. After finishing, conduct a final water test to confirm the drain functions correctly and that there are no leaks. Proper installation of the drain with the correct slope ensures a functional and long-lasting shower trench drain system.

Seal and Test: Apply silicone sealant, let dry, then test for leaks and functionality

Once the trench drain is properly trimmed and fitted into the shower area, the next critical step is to seal it to prevent water leakage and ensure long-term durability. Begin by cleaning the edges around the drain and the drain itself to remove any debris, dust, or residue. Use a mild detergent and water, followed by a thorough rinse and drying process. Ensuring the surface is clean and dry is essential for the silicone sealant to adhere properly. Once prepared, apply a high-quality, waterproof silicone sealant along the edges of the trench drain, pressing it firmly into the gap between the drain and the shower floor. Use a caulking gun for precision and a sealant tool or your finger (wearing a glove) to smooth the silicone, creating a neat and even bead.

After applying the silicone sealant, allow it to dry completely according to the manufacturer’s instructions. Drying times can vary depending on the product and environmental conditions, but typically range from 24 to 48 hours. Avoid exposing the sealant to water or moisture during this period to ensure it cures properly. Proper curing is crucial for creating a watertight seal that will prevent leaks and water damage. If possible, maintain good ventilation in the bathroom to aid the drying process.

Once the silicone sealant is fully cured, it’s time to test the trench drain for leaks and functionality. Start by running water into the shower and observing how it flows into the drain. Ensure the water is directed toward the trench and that it drains efficiently without pooling or backing up. Check the area around the drain for any signs of water seepage or leakage, paying close attention to the sealed edges. If you notice any leaks, allow the area to dry completely, remove the faulty sealant, and reapply a fresh bead of silicone, ensuring it is properly smoothed and pressed into the gap.

In addition to testing for leaks, verify the functionality of the trench drain by simulating heavy water flow, such as during a shower. Use a bucket or hose to pour water rapidly into the drain to ensure it can handle the volume without overflowing or causing backups. Inspect the underside of the shower floor or the area below the drain (if accessible) for any signs of moisture or leakage. If everything appears dry and the drain functions as expected, the sealing process is successful.

Finally, perform periodic checks in the weeks following the installation to ensure the sealant remains intact and the drain continues to function properly. Regular maintenance, such as cleaning the drain and inspecting the sealant, will help prolong its lifespan and prevent future issues. By following these steps to seal and test the trench drain, you can ensure a watertight, functional, and durable shower drainage system.
